Get your devices secured by using Encryption
Encryption is a process that converts a readable message or text into a code that cannot be easily understood by any individual, also known as ciphertext. Encryption can be of many types, some of which are listed below.
- Internet traffic encryption
- On-device data encryption
- Cloud encryption
- Email encryption
- Message encryption
Globally, the Android operating system is a leader in its sphere with a 71% market share, so let us get started and learn the basic steps of using Android OS encryption.
- First of all, make sure that your phone battery is at 80%.
- Secondly, make sure that all the data is backed up on the device or online.
- You must have the updated version of the OS.
- For the encryption, go to Settings > Security.
- Click the option “Encrypt Phone.” Having clicked this option, the encryption process will get started.
- Keep your mobile connected to the charger until the encryption is done.

Using a VPN
VPN basically stands for virtual private networks that protect your identity even in case you use public or shared Wi-Fi.
How can you enable a VPN for a device using the Android operating system?
There are several VPN applications available that can help you safeguard your online privacy.
Other than that, here are some basic steps if you want to manually set up a VPN for the device with Android as an operating system.
- Go into Settings of your Android phone.
- Hit the Network & Internet option.
- Click Advanced.
- Click the Plus sign.
- Enter your administrator information.
Preventing brute force attacks for online privacy
Do you know who brute force attackers are? If you don’t know, let’s get to know more about them. Brute force attackers try to hack online accounts by blindly submitting various passwords or passphrases to unlock your accounts until they reach the correct passcode.
How to tackle brute force attackers:
- Lock accounts
- Block the root via SSH
Lock accounts
You can fix your online privacy and tackle brute force attackers simply by locking your accounts after attempting the wrong passwords several times.
Block the root via SSH
One can also secure online privacy by making the root user inaccessible via SSH by editing the sshd_config file.
Reduce Digital Footprints
Before moving forward, you must be curious to know what digital footprints are. These refer to your online activity, communications, and contributions that are stored while you are online.
By reducing these digital footprints, you can minimize online privacy risks. The next question arises: how can we reduce our digital footprint?
You can minimize it in several ways, some of which are mentioned below.
- Keep your social media private.
- Inspect and investigate those who send you a friend request anonymously.
- Turn off the location.
- Unsubscribe from all the emails you no longer use. Closing unused accounts will minimize the risk of breaching your online privacy by hackers/ scammers.

Fortify your online privacy by turning off irrelevant trackers and clearing browsers
Getting the anti-malware or consulting a cyber security professional can be a bit costly. But do you know that one of the most common and inexpensive methods of securing online privacy is turning off unnecessary trackers, including your activity, usage and location history tracking, clearing your browser, and turning off ad preferences?
You must consider how to do all the above-mentioned for different browsers. So here is how to do it.
Chrome: Settings > Privacy & Security > Clear browsing history > Select what you want to clear
Safari: Setting > Safari > Clear history and website data
Edge: Settings and More > Settings > Clearing browsing history data > Select the option you want to clear
